# The Catalog File is another B-tree that contains records for all the files and directories stored in the volume.
It stores four types of records.
Each file consists of a File Thread Record and a File Record while each directory consists of a Directory Thread Record and a Directory Record.
Files and directories in the Catalog File are located by their unique Catalog Node ID ( or CNID ).
